Centro Escolar in title defense

- By KRISTEL SATUMBAGA

The 48th WNCAA unfolds Saturday at the Philsports Arena in Pasig City with Centro Escolar University seeking to retain its overall title in the seniors division.

Juanita Alamillo, assistant to the Vice President for Student AffairsAth­letics, said their athletes have been preparing hard to live up to their billing as the league adds another school in its member roster in University of Makati.

The Scorpions reigned in all sports except in futsal and volleyball.

With the theme "Audacia Sin Limites," a Spanish phrase which means "Courage Without Limits," this season expects a more competitiv­e tournament in badminton, basketball, cheerleadi­ng, cheerdance, futsal, poomsae, softball, swimming, taekwondo, table tennis and volleyball.

Host Saint Pedro Poveda College has invited an alumna as guest speaker in the 10 a.m. opening ceremonies.

"We hope that our athletes would live up to our theme in being courageous to achieve their goals not only in sports, but also in life," said WNCAA executive director Vivian Manila.

Member schools are Angelicum College, Assumption College San Lorenzo, CEU, Chiang Kai Shek, La Salle Zobel, La Salle CollegeAnt­ipolo, Miriam College, Philippine Women's University, Saint Jude Catholic School, Saint Pedro Poveda College, San Beda College Alabang, St. Paul College Pasig, St. Scholastic­a's College, St. Stephen's High School, University of Asia and the Pacific and new member University of Makati.
